The International Trade Administration and/or International Trade Commission have recently announced the following actions in antidumping and/or countervailing duty cases.
Aluminum sheet 每 (1) preliminary affirmative CV duty determinations on common alloy aluminum sheet from Bahrain (net subsidy rate of 9.49 percent), Brazil (0.76 and 1.32 percent), India (4.55 to 34.84 percent), and Turkey (0.07 and 3.15 percent); (2) new requirement for CV duty cash deposits at the specified rates (except where de minimis); (3) preliminary negative critical circumstances determination with respect to India; and (4) preliminary affirmative critical circumstances determination with respect to Turkey
Barium carbonate 每 sunset review determination that revocation of AD duty order on barium carbonate from China would be likely to lead to continuation or recurrence of material injury to an industry in the U.S. within a reasonably foreseeable time
Citric acid 每 (1) dumping margins of zero to 54.11 percent in preliminary results of administrative review of AD duty order on citric acid and certain citrate salts from Thailand for the period Jan. 8, 2018, through June 30, 2019, and (2) sunset review determination that revocation of AD duty order on citric acid and certain citrate salts from China would be likely to lead to continuation or recurrence of dumping at margins up to 156.87 percent
Ferrovanadium 每 sunset review determination that revocation of AD duty orders on ferrovanadium from China and South Africa would be likely to lead to continuation or recurrence of material injury to an industry in the U.S. within a reasonably foreseeable time
